Description
Nestled between two mountains in northeastern Iceland, this quiet town stretches along the south side of a fjord and is set around a nice lagoon. It was settled around 1848 by Norwegian fisherman and some of their original wooden buildings still stand in the town. The road to Seydisfdordur (Rt.93) goes over a mountain pass and connects the town to the larger town of Egilsstadir, about 17 miles to the west. The town is quite quaint and features some interesting painted buildings, a small harbor and is surrounded by beautiful mountain scenery. It remains a significant fishing port but its main focus today is tourism.
